Key Responsibilities

  • Manage all submission of briefs received from Agents/Managers in the branch for their marketing campaigns;
  • Liaise with the Agent and Regional Marketing on the execution of briefs and communicating any updates or changes on the brief from the agents and marketing;
  • Liaise with internal and external stakeholders on timing and deliverables of various projects, ensuring briefs are actioned and content delivered on time;
  • Ensure delivery of collateral to the various stakeholders on time and in full;
  • Manage traffic daily on project management software (ClickUp);
  • Update information on our website, specifically for Branch Developments, ensuring accuracy, as and when applicable;
  • Management of our marketing server and Lucid Press, ensuring that folders are organized appropriately;
  • Managing submissions to the Regional Marketing team for all branch and national publications and media;
  • Briefing of external email campaigns;
  • Liaise with Agents to create content for social media campaigns, and briefing to Regional Marketing for execution as and when required;
  • Liaise with Agents to create hyper-local campaigns and ensure delivery thereof;
  • Create digital and print marketing collateral from Lucidpress templates and Alchemy as required. Keep up to date with templates available and communicate to agents;
  • Liaise with external suppliers when necessary;
  • Manage accounts with marketing suppliers and ensure timeous payments;
  • Manage branch signage contracts and renewals, liaise with signage suppliers alongside Branch Managers;
  • Train agents on how to use new marketing collateral as and when developed by Regional and or National Marketing;
  • Assist Regional Marketing with any branch marketing events, expos, agent activations or meetings.
  • Brief geotargeted hyperlocal social media campaigns in collaboration with Regional Social Media Coordinator and ensure delivery thereof;
  • Manage, coordinate and give feedback on all leads that are generated from each campaign;
  • Monitor and communicate the progress of each campaign to the agent and Branch Managers;
  • Manage the collation of property collections and ensure adequate distribution across all channels;
  • Ad-hoc support to Agents with the design and printing of brochures and drops, or creating Digital versions;
  • Any other duties as and when may be required by management that are within the area of your expertise.

Key Competencies

  • Project management skills – working with competing deadlines, managing input and sign-off from stakeholders, ensuring that collateral is ready for campaign go-lives;
  • Process driven – pulling together briefs, chase lists and plans from various sources per campaign and ensure delivery against these on time and in full;
  • Excellent traffic management skills and the ability to work with designers and additional stakeholders;
  • Proven abilities in Social Media Management (Community Management and scheduling);
  • The ability to build relationships with internal stakeholders with a willingness to actively support the Agents, Branch Managers and the Regional Marketing team;
  • Deadline driven with the ability to multi-task, whilst maintaining the quality standards of delivery;
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ills;
  • Excellent organisational and administrative skills;
  • Self-motivated and energetic;
  • Attention to detail and enhanced accuracy;
  • Must work well under pressure and easily adapt to change.

Education & Experience

  • A relevant qualification in Digital and/or Traditional Marketing;
  • 3+ years of experience in a Co-ordinator role within a Marketing department;
  • CMS or CRM platform (Email, website, ) experience is essential.

Knowledge & Skills Required

  • Experience in software such as Lucid Press, WordPress, MS Powerpoint, MS Word, Excel, Outlook, Google Products is essential;
  • Experience in Adobe and In Design will be an added advantage;
  • Social Media and Design experience will be an advantage;
  • Previous experience working in an Agency environment will be advantageous.
